"The simple, Protestant church in neo-Gothic style is a place of silence and devotion on the promenade along the Passer, from which there is access. In front of it, on the waterfront, an art mile was created in 2015, 2016 and 2017 under the title PeoplePictures with worth seeing, some very abstract works by prominent artists such as the German sculptor Stefan Strahlhol."

🚇 🗺️ Getting There
The church is located on the promenade along the Passer river in Merano, making it easily accessible by foot. If arriving by car, look for nearby parking facilities.
Merano has a good public transport system. Buses frequently run along the main routes, and the church's central location means most stops will be within a short walk. Check local bus schedules for the most convenient routes.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
No, entry to the Evangelical Church of Christ is generally free. It's a place of worship and community, open for visitors to experience its beauty and tranquility.
The church is reported to be open most days, offering opportunities for visits. However, specific hours can vary, so it's advisable to check locally or during your visit for the most accurate times.
The 'PeoplePictures' art mile in front of the church features works by prominent artists. While the church itself is free to enter, it's best to inquire locally about any specific access or viewing details for the art installations.

Architectural Significance
One of the most celebrated features of the church is its beautiful stained-glass windows. These intricate works of art not only illuminate the interior with vibrant colors but also tell stories through their detailed imagery, adding a layer of spiritual and artistic depth to the visitor experience. The interplay of light and color through these windows creates a truly mesmerizing effect, making them a must-see for any visitor.
Beyond its religious function, the church's exterior is complemented by the 'PeoplePictures' art mile. This initiative, launched in recent years, showcases works by prominent artists, including German sculptor Stefan Strahlhol. This integration of contemporary art with historical architecture creates a unique cultural landscape, inviting visitors to engage with both spiritual and artistic expressions.
